Absolutely! One website that is both fun and educational for 4th grade students to explore is NASA's Kids' Club. Here's how to find it:

1. Open a web browser on your computer.
2. In the search bar, type "NASA's Kids' Club" and press Enter.
3. Click on the link that says "NASA's Kid's Club" or "NASA's Kid's Club - NASA's Space Place."
4. Once you're on the website, you'll find numerous interactive games, puzzles, and activities for kids to learn about space, the Earth, and other planets.
5. Encourage your students to click on different sections within the website to explore various topics, such as weather, satellites, solar system, and spacecraft.

NASA's Kids' Club provides engaging content that makes learning about space and our planet exciting for children. The website also includes videos, images, and articles that help expand their knowledge. It's a great resource to spark curiosity and foster a love for science in your students.
